Product Overview

Category

The MXLRT100KP51A belongs to the category of electronic components, specifically a transient voltage suppressor (TVS) diode.

Use

It is used to protect sensitive electronic components from voltage spikes and transients in various circuits and systems.

Characteristics

  • High surge capability
  • Low clamping voltage
  • Fast response time
  • RoHS compliant

Package

The MXLRT100KP51A is available in a surface mount package.

Essence

The essence of this product lies in its ability to quickly divert excessive voltage away from sensitive components, thereby safeguarding them from damage.

Packaging/Quantity

The MXLRT100KP51A is typically packaged in reels and is available in varying quantities depending on the manufacturer's specifications.

Specifications

  • Peak Pulse Power: 1000W
  • Standoff Voltage: 51V
  • Breakdown Voltage: 56.7V
  • Maximum Clamping Voltage: 82.4V
  • Operating Temperature Range: -55°C to 150°C

Working Principles

The MXLRT100KP51A operates by shunting excess voltage away from the protected circuit when a transient event occurs, thereby limiting the voltage across the protected components.

Detailed Application Field Plans

The MXLRT100KP51A is commonly used in: - Power supply units - Communication equipment - Automotive electronics - Industrial control systems
